事件冒泡

js怎么實現輪播圖效果 js實現輪播圖的5個關鍵步驟講解-小浪學習網

js怎么實現輪播圖效果 js實現輪播圖的5個關鍵步驟講解

輪播圖的實現主要包括html結構搭建、css樣式設置、js控制切換等步驟。1. html結構需要包含容器、圖片列表、指示器和控制按鈕;2. css需設置容器尺寸、隱藏溢出內容并使用flex布局排列圖片,同時...
站長的頭像-小浪學習網月度會員站長4天前
429
JavaScript中的事件冒泡和捕獲有什么區別?-小浪學習網

JavaScript中的事件冒泡和捕獲有什么區別?

事件冒泡是從最具體的元素開始逐級向上傳遞,而事件捕獲是從最不具體的元素開始逐級向下傳遞。1. 事件冒泡適用于處理復雜用戶交互,如表單驗證。2. 事件捕獲適用于優先處理某些事件,如全局錯誤...
站長的頭像-小浪學習網月度會員站長48天前
479
如何防止子元素的單擊事件影響父元素的雙擊事件?-小浪學習網

如何防止子元素的單擊事件影響父元素的雙擊事件?

巧妙解決子元素點擊與父元素雙擊事件沖突 在父元素綁定雙擊事件(dblclick),子元素綁定單擊事件(click)時,快速點擊子元素可能誤觸發父元素的雙擊事件。本文提供兩種方法有效避免此沖突。 假設...
站長的頭像-小浪學習網月度會員站長2個月前
469
js怎么實現右鍵菜單 js自定義右鍵菜單的5個實現步驟-小浪學習網

js怎么實現右鍵菜單 js自定義右鍵菜單的5個實現步驟

實現js自定義右鍵菜單需遵循5個步驟:1.監聽contextmenu事件,在document或目標元素上綁定事件處理函數;2.使用event.preventdefault()阻止瀏覽器默認菜單;3.創建包含菜單項的html結構,如div...
站長的頭像-小浪學習網月度會員站長14小時前
319
CKEditor5中如何攔截A標簽的Ctrl/Command+點擊跳轉?-小浪學習網

CKEditor5中如何攔截A標簽的Ctrl/Command+點擊跳轉?

ckeditor5中攔截a標簽跳轉的有效方案 在CKEditor5富文本編輯器中,使用link和autolink插件生成的鏈接(a標簽)默認會在用戶按下Ctrl/Command鍵的同時點擊時跳轉。 然而,某些應用場景需要攔截此...
站長的頭像-小浪學習網月度會員站長3個月前
438
js怎么處理鼠標滾輪事件-小浪學習網

js怎么處理鼠標滾輪事件

在 javascript 中,處理鼠標滾輪事件主要使用 wheel 事件。1) 基本實現:使用 document.addeventlistener('wheel', function(event) { ... }),通過 event.deltay 獲取滾動方向,event.preventd...
站長的頭像-小浪學習網月度會員站長36天前
328
怎樣用JavaScript觸發自定義事件?-小浪學習網

怎樣用JavaScript觸發自定義事件?

用javascript觸發自定義事件的步驟是:1. 創建事件,使用customevent構造函數;2. 派發事件,使用dispatchevent方法。具體操作是先通過customevent創建一個名為mycustomevent的事件,并可通過de...
站長的頭像-小浪學習網月度會員站長31天前
258
H5 前端開發中的事件委托是什么意思-小浪學習網

H5 前端開發中的事件委托是什么意思

事件委托通過事件冒泡機制將事件監聽器綁定到父元素上,減少內存消耗和提高性能。1)利用dom事件冒泡,將事件監聽器添加到共同祖先元素。2)通過event.target判斷具體點擊的子元素。3)適用于動...
站長的頭像-小浪學習網月度會員站長48天前
468
Vue.js 與 jQuery 在前端開發中的不同點-小浪學習網

Vue.js 與 jQuery 在前端開發中的不同點

vue.js 和 jquery 在開發理念、使用方式和性能表現上存在顯著差異。1. vue.js 采用組件化和響應式數據驅動,適合構建大型應用。2. jquery 則專注于簡化 dom 操作,適用于小型項目。選擇時需考慮...
站長的頭像-小浪學習網月度會員站長1個月前
277
怎樣用JavaScript操作DOM元素?-小浪學習網

怎樣用JavaScript操作DOM元素?

javascript操作dom元素可以通過以下步驟實現:使用document.getelementbyid或document.queryselector選擇dom元素。修改元素內容,如通過textcontent屬性改變文本。動態添加元素,使用createelem...
站長的頭像-小浪學習網月度會員站長26天前
317